Transaction 64e4315aa9f4a2f10e8a77c4d57987721fd6d9b79b764516bed9c93ae4357c76
1 Input
2 Outputs
- 64e4315aa9f4a2f10e8a77c4d57987721fd6d9b79b764516bed9c93ae4357c76:0
- 64e4315aa9f4a2f10e8a77c4d57987721fd6d9b79b764516bed9c93ae4357c76:1
value 544260000
address 35EAYWQmq7nwBYqkYNLZKZf5WAY4sXs7BT
value 10186829948
address 1Ptv5qNTg6bpoMrH8zKqpiSA62jC3i76Nr